Backseat Seal Replacement
Warning: This procedure is for sizes DN 80-200 only
Is the backseat seal damaged?
If the backseat seal is damaged, it must be replaced.
Has the spindle been screwed out of the bonnet?
Has the original backseat seal been carefully removed?
Has a new backseat seal been mounted in the angled contact surface directly inside the opening in the bonnet?
Has any dirt been removed from the body before the valve is assembled?
Has the cone been screwed back towards the bonnet before it is replaced in the valve body?
Enter the torque wrench tightening value for the bonnet
Shut-off Valve Maintenance
Warning: Do not remove the packing gland if there is internal pressure in the valve.
Is the valve fully open?
Attach a handwheel or similar on top of the spindle for pressure equalization.
Is the pressure equalized?
Handwheel and packing gland can now be removed.
Is the valve still under pressure?
Do not remove the bonnet while the valve is still under pressure.
Is the flat gasket (pos. A) damaged?
Is the spindle free of scratches and impact marks?
Cone Replacement
Warning: This procedure requires trained personnel with PPE!
Unscrew the cone screw (pos. B) with an Allen key
Select the Allen key size used
Compress the disk spring (pos. D) and remove the balls (pos. C)
Number of balls removed
Remove the cone
Place the new cone on the spindle
Place the disk spring (pos. D) between the spindle and the cone
Compress the disk spring and replace the balls (pos. C)
